Advanced Materials

Advanced materials significantly improve vehicle performance and durability. Carbon fiber reinforcements provide structural strength while reducing weight, allowing for faster acceleration and improved handling. Composite materials enhance crash safety, absorbing impacts more effectively than traditional metals. Additionally, heat-resistant alloys contribute to better engine performance under extreme conditions, ensuring reliability during rigorous races. Racing teams utilize these materials to develop competitive advantages, fostering ongoing research into lighter and stronger alternatives.

Cutting-Edge Electronics

Cutting-edge electronics revolutionize motorsports through increased data analysis and real-time communication. Teams employ sophisticated telemetry systems to monitor various parameters, such as tire pressure and fuel efficiency, during races. High-performance software algorithms analyze this data, providing insights for strategy adjustments. Furthermore, advancements in vehicle-to-vehicle and vehicle-to-infrastructure communication enhance situational awareness on the track. Safety systems, like electronic stability control and advanced driver-assistance systems, streamline race operations while improving driver safety. Investing in these technologies ensures racing remains competitive and safe, benefiting not only motorsports but also consumer automotive safety.

Data Analytics in Racing

Data analytics transforms racing by offering real-time insights into vehicle dynamics and driver performance. Teams utilize advanced telemetry systems to collect and analyze vast amounts of data during races. This analysis informs strategic decisions, such as pit stop timing and tire selection. Machine learning algorithms process historical performance data, identifying patterns that enhance race strategies. Continuous data streams assist engineers in tuning vehicle setups for different tracks and conditions, ensuring peak performance.

Aerodynamics and Design

Aerodynamics plays a critical role in motorsports, directly impacting speed and stability. Engineers use computational fluid dynamics (CFD) to simulate airflow around vehicles, optimizing shapes for minimal drag and maximum downforce. Innovations in wing design, body contours, and vent systems enhance aerodynamic efficiency, allowing for faster lap times. Lightweight materials like carbon fiber contribute to both performance and safety, reinforcing structures without adding excessive weight. These design advancements are crucial for achieving competitive advantages on the track.

Electric and Hybrid Technologies

Electric and hybrid technologies play a significant role in shaping the future of motorsports. Major racing series, such as Formula E, showcase the capabilities of fully electric vehicles, promoting sustainability while delivering high-speed racing. Hybrid powertrains combine electric motors with traditional combustion engines, enhancing performance and fuel efficiency. Manufacturers invest heavily in battery technology, aiming for longer ranges and faster charging times. For instance, the Formula Hybrid series demonstrates the viability of these technologies in competitive settings, allowing teams to maximize energy recovery and utilization during races. As regulations push for lower emissions, these technologies will likely become standard in various racing disciplines, driving further innovations in energy management systems.

Autonomous Racing Vehicles

Autonomous racing vehicles mark a revolutionary shift in motorsport. Developments in artificial intelligence and machine learning allow vehicles to perform complex maneuvers with minimal human intervention. Organizations like Roborace promote driverless racing, testing the limits of technology and showcasing advancements in robotics and sensing technologies. Competition among self-driving vehicles establishes new metrics for speed, precision, and decision-making under pressure. For example, systems using LiDAR and advanced cameras provide real-time situational awareness, enabling vehicles to navigate safely on the track. As these technologies mature, they may influence the broader automotive industry, enhancing safety features and paving the way for fully autonomous consumer vehicles.
